Etymology
From Latin speciēs + Middle Low German daler. Originally dalar in specie (“thaler in one piece”), as opposed to dalar courant (“thaler in multiple small coins”).
Noun
spesidalar m (plural spesidalaren)
- (historical) speciedaler (Dano-Norwegian currency from the 16th century until 1875)
